We hope you’ll join us on Sunday, April 21 at 2:30 in Room 205 for a screening and discussion of the film “The Letter.” The Letter is a film that tells the story of a journey of frontline leaders, both young and old from around the world, who are experiencing the traumatic effects of global warming.  At the invitation from the Pope, they travel to Rome to share their experiences and discuss the encyclical letter ‘Laudato Si’ with Pope Francis. The letter was written in May 2015 to the world to lament environmental degradation and global warming and invites all people of the world to take “swift and unified global action” to heal the environment.
